                                     PART I
                                          
              INFORMATION REQUIRED IN THE SECTION (10a) PROSPECTUS
                                          
(A)  GENERAL PLAN INFORMATION

     (1)       The title of the "plan" is:  "Global Media
               Corporation/Compensation Contract", and the registrant whose
               securities are to be offered pursuant to the plan is Peacock
               Financial Corporation.

     (2)       Global Media Corporation is a consultant to the registrant, and
               in such consulting capacity has entered into a written
               compensation contract for services rendered to registrant. Such
               written compensation contract is defined as an "Employee Benefit
               Plan" pursuant to Rule 405 of "REGULATION C-REGISTRATION" under
               the Securities Act of 1933.

     (3)       The plan is not subject to the provisions of the Employee
               Retirement Income Security Act of 1974 ("ERISA").

(B)  SECURITIES TO BE OFFERED

     (1)       28,570 shares of registrant's common stock

     (2)       The Capital Stock to be issued are the common shares of the
               registrant that are fully paid and non assessable,  with the same
               rights and privileges as all other common stock shareholders of
               the registrant.   There are no restrictions on alienability of
               the securities to be registered,  nor is there any provision
               discriminating against any existing or prospective holder of such
               securities as a result of such security holder owning a
               substantial amount of securities.

(D)  PURCHASE OF SECURITIES PURSUANT TO THE PLAN AND PAYMENT FOR SECURITIES
     OFFERED.  

     (6)       The plan is not subject to ERISA.  The shares of registrant's
               common stock to be issued to Global Media Corporation is
               compensation for services rendered to registrant.  The securities
               issued pursuant to this Registration shall be issued by
               registrant without the payment of any fees,  commissions or other
               charges of any kind.

(E)  RESALE RESTRICTIONS

               There are no restrictions on the resale of the securities
               purchased under this plan that may be imposed upon the purchaser.
